Falcon Trace, Orlando, FL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Falcon Trace?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Falcon Trace Studio Apartments | $1,545 | $1,095 | $1,722 |
| Falcon Trace 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,663 | $1,100 | $2,496 |
| Falcon Trace 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,038 | $1,299 | $5,025 |
| Falcon Trace 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,388 | $1,501 | $8,178 |
| Falcon Trace 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,671 | $1,668 | $3,280 |
